The Huawei P30 Pro and the iPhone 11 Pro Max, both released in 2019, represented flagship offerings from their respective manufacturers. The P30 Pro, launched in March 2019, operates on Android with Huawei's EMUI interface, while the iPhone 11 Pro Max, released in September 2019, runs on Apple's iOS. These devices primarily differentiate themselves through their camera systems and software ecosystems, catering to distinct user preferences.

The Huawei P30 Pro and iPhone 11 Pro Max, both released in 2019, offer distinct experiences tailored to different user priorities. The P30 Pro is frequently praised for its exceptional camera system, particularly its low-light capabilities and impressive optical zoom, which were groundbreaking at its release. Users also often highlight its long-lasting battery life, often extending to two days of use. Some criticisms have focused on the software experience due to the impact of external factors on Android updates and the lack of a higher resolution display compared to some competitors. The iPhone 11 Pro Max is widely recognized for its powerful processing performance, ensuring smooth operation across demanding applications and games. Its display is noted for its brightness and color accuracy, and its battery life was a significant improvement over previous iPhone models, often providing extensive usage on a single charge. User feedback often points to the robust iOS ecosystem and consistent software updates as key advantages. Some users have found its size and weight to be substantial, impacting one-handed use. Users prioritizing advanced photography features, especially optical zoom and low-light performance, coupled with extended battery life, may find the Huawei P30 Pro well-suited to their needs. Conversely, individuals who value a highly optimized software experience, strong overall performance, and a slightly sharper display, along with a robust app ecosystem, might lean towards the iPhone 11 Pro Max.
